Immigration News - Global mobility, Immigration fees, Permanent Residency, Canada Canada | Annual fee increases for citizenship and immigration applications Share this article LinkedIn Facebook X (Twitter) March 30, 2026 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ada published its annual fee increases for certain citizenship and immigration applications, including those for permanent residence and right of citizenship. Key takeaways: Fees for all permanent residence applications will increase on April 30, 2026: Right of permanent residence fee will increase to CA$600 (about US$431) Provincial Nominee Program fee will increase to CA$990 (about US$711) Business fee will increase to CA$1,895 (about US$1,361) Family class fee will increase to CA$570 (about US$409) Protected persons fee will increase to CA$660 (about US$474) Humanitarian and compassionate grounds or public policy measures fee will increase to CA$660 (about US$474) Permit holders fee will increase to CA$390 (about US$280) The right of citizenship fee for adult applicants will increase to CA$123 (about US$88) on March 31, 2026. The adult citizenship grant application processing fee remains unchanged at CA$530 (about US$381). Removal fees for people removed on or after April 1, 2025, are increasing April 1, 2026. The fee for those with escorted removal by air (except medical escort) will increase to CA$13,098.96 (about US$9,408). The fee for other types of removal will increase to CA$3,905.28 (about US$2,805). Applications received on or after the indicated dates will be subject to the new fees.
